Diagnostics:
The Stroke Diagnostic market is comprised of various technologies and procedures used to accurately diagnose and identify the type of stroke a patient may be experiencing. The key types of diagnostics include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I), Computed Tomography Scan (CT scan), Electrocardiography, Carotid Ultrasound, Cerebral Angiography, and others. These diagnostic tools play a crucial role in the early detection and treatment of strokes by providing valuable information about the affected area of the brain and the extent of damage.
Therapeutics:
The Stroke Therapeutics market focuses on the different treatments and medication options available for stroke patients. The key types of therapeutics include Tissue Plasminogen Activator, Antiplatelet drugs, Antihypertensive medications, and Anticoagulants. These therapeutic interventions are essential in managing and preventing further complications associated with strokes, such as recurrent strokes or long-term disabilities.
Application:
There are two main types of strokes Haemorrhagic Stroke and Ischemic Stroke. Haemorrhagic strokes occur when a weakened blood vessel ruptures and bleeds into the surrounding brain tissue, while Ischemic strokes are caused by a blockage or clot in a blood vessel that prevents blood flow to the brain. The distinction between these two types of strokes is important in determining the most effective treatment approach and ensuring optimal patient outcomes.
